Eberbach is a city in Odenwald on the Neckar in Baden-Wuerttemberg.
background
The city of Eberbach was founded in the 13th century on the right bank of the Neckar. She lies in Baden-Wuerttemberg on the border to Hesse. Since the municipal reform in 1971-1975, it has included the districts of Brombach, Friedrichsdorf, Igelsbach, Lindach, Rockenau, Gaimühle, Neckarwimmersbach and Schöllenbach as well as a number of other courtyards and residential areas.
Neighboring places are Mudau, Waldbrunn (Odenwald) and Schönbrunn (Baden) as well as the Hessian places Staghorn, Rothenberg, Sensbach valley, Beerfelden and Hesseck. The demarcation appears to be quite arbitrary and sometimes runs through the middle of a town. The small town of Brombach is a special case; it is an enclave surrounded by Hirschhorn and Rothenberg.

The 1 Eberbach station is located on the Neckar Valley Railwaythat of Mannheim above Heidelberg through Eberbach and further over Heilbronn to Stuttgart leads. The lines also run on this route S1 and S2 the Rhein-Neckar S-Bahn. Eberbach is also located on the Odenwaldbahnso that also connections over Erbach, Michelstadt to Hanau and Darmstadt, Hanau and also Frankfurt am Main consist.

Eberbach is on the B37that comes from Heidelberg and through the Neckar valley towards Mosbach goes. About the B45 there are connections after Erbach and Michelstadt in the Odenwald.
The Castle Road leads through the place.

The old town of Eberbach is surrounded by four very differently designed towers of the former city fortifications.
- 1 Reel tower. dates from the 14th century. It is believed that the windowless ground floor was used as a dungeon, as it is only accessible from above via a winch (reel) through a narrow shaft. The
- 2 Rose tower. was originally called the Roßbrunnenturm, dates from the 13th century and is the oldest and at the same time the only round tower of the city fortifications. The

- There are also a number of other historical buildings in the old town. These include:
- the Eberbacher Hof and the Bettendorf House in half-timbered style
- the 5 Old City Hall , today a museum, in the classical Weinbrenner style
- the catholic church 6 St. John Nepomuk and the evangelical 7 Michaeliskirche
- the 8 Hotel carp with his sgrafitto paintings
- The 9 Ohrsberg Tower on the Ohrberg; this 237 m high hill is a former circulating mountain of the Neckar and towers over the old town
- To the east of the city are the ruins of the 10 Eberbach castle ruins on a hill about 320 m high.
- That is a specialty 11 Arboretum in the north of the urban area on Pestalozzistraße.
- The tallest tree in Germany is said to be in Eberbach, a Douglas fir over 62 m high.
